A leading company in nuclear engineering located in Scotland is seeking a Senior Engineer for Control and Instrumentation (C&I) to manage engineering processes. The successful candidate will provide technical oversight and lead multidisciplinary teams, ensuring compliance with safety and operational standards.

Candidates should have:

  • a degree in engineering
  • proven C&I experience
  • familiarity with electrical engineering principles

Benefits include substantial annual leave, pension contributions, and ongoing professional development opportunities.
